myCollection=[m1,m2,m3,m4,m5,m6,m7,m8,m9,m10]
# Display First actor in the actor list of the Last movie in collection
# print(myCollection[-1]['Actors'][0])
# Generate a List of All movie Titles
# print([m['Title'] for m in myCollection])
## Without List Comprehension
# t=[]
# for m in myCollection:
# t.append(m['Title'])
# print(t)
# Generate a List of movie titles with Genre Action
# print([m['Title'] for m in myCollection if 'Action' in m['Genre']])
## Without List Comprehension
# t=[]
# for m in myCollection:
# if('Action' in m['Genre']):
# t.append(m['Title'])
# print(t)
# Generate a List of all Genres in the collection
# print(list({g for m in myCollection for g in m['Genre']}))
## Without Set Comprehension
# gen=set()
# for m in myCollection:
# for g in m['Genre']:
# gen.add(g)
# gen=list(gen)
# print(gen)
# Generate a List of all Actors who have worked with Director "Christopher Nolan"
# print(list({a for m in myCollection for a in m['Actors'] if m['Director']=="Christopher Nolan"}))
## Without Set Comprehension
# act=set()
# for m in myCollection:
# if(m['Director']=="Christopher Nolan"):
# for a in m['Actors']:
# act.add(a)
# act=list(act)
# print(act)
# Create a Dictionry with key as Director name and value as list of his Movie Titles
# d={}
# for m in myCollection:
# if(m['Director'] not in d):
# d[m['Director']]=[m['Title']]
# else:
# d[m['Director']].append(m['Title'])
# print(d)
# Create a Dictionry with keys as Actor Names and value as number of movies
# d={}
# for m in myCollection:
# for a in m['Actors']:
# if(a not in d):
# d[a]=1
# else:
# d[a]+=1
# print(d)
# Create a Ditionary with key as Genre and Value as List of Movies of that Genre
# d={}
# for m in myCollection:
# for g in m['Genre']:
# if(g not in d):
# d[g]=[m['Title']]
# else:
# d[g].append(m['Title'])
# for k,v in d.items():
# print(f'{k}\t{v}')
# Generate a List of Actors who have worked in both Drama and Action movies
## Wrong Approach
# a=[]
# for m in myCollection:
# for act in m['Actors']:
# if({'Action','Drama'}.issubset(m['Genre'])):
# a.append(act)
# print(a)
## Correct Approach
# actionActors={a for m in myCollection for a in m['Actors'] if 'Action' in m['Genre']}
# dramaActors={a for m in myCollection for a in m['Actors'] if 'Drama' in m['Genre']}
# print(list(actionActors.intersection(dramaActors)))
# Find total RunTime of all movies in collection
# t=0
# for m in myCollection:
# t+=m['Runtime']
# print(t)
